We have an opening for a part-time, 20 hours per week in-office role to keep our residential property auction database up-to-date and current. (WFH not available for this job.)
This is a data entry position that requires accuracy and timeliness. The flow of items to process varies; it can be slow at times, very pressured at others.
It can be up to an four-hours per day role, generally between 10am to 2pm. But if the work flow requires, it may need to run until later. Our readers, users and journalists expect this data to be fully up-to-date all the time. (We do have some emergency backup available.)
You will need good keyboard skills. And you will need to be comfortable working in an open office. More importantly, you must have a good understanding of New Zealand's urban geography, and housing market structure.
We will train you. The role starts in July 2026. There may be other similar activities required to be undertaken over time.
You must be a citizen or permanent resident. And a non-smoker/non-vaper. The role is in Herne Bay, Auckland.
